Output 84c764923cae2e72b6d36a5aca276f2787e2f1c356e900af3028832510536557:0

value
389827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5af2799dcc3e7909aa8be5ef3a207d24df01fcd8 OP_EQUALVERIFY OP_CHECKSIG
address
19HtHjCTakMhsXoJGXaZ68rSfNjEzWNDK7
transaction
84c764923cae2e72b6d36a5aca276f2787e2f1c356e900af3028832510536557
spent
true